Attention ATTENTION
Listening to Your Children

ABSTRACT
Do you ever think that your children don’t listen to a word you say? Does it seem like at times you have to repeat yourself 3 or 4 times to get a response from them? Have you ever thought that they might feel the same way about you? Do your children ever tell you that you never listen to them? Listening and communication needs to work from both sides, because communication is a two way street. While you are the parent and expect a certain degree of respect, it is a lot easier to attain that respect when you listen carefully to what your children have to say.

Family ValuesQuotes
About family values

Accountability
"Good men are bound by conscience and liberated by accountability."
~ Wes Fessler
Adversity
"In life's darkest moments are the most brilliant opportunities to shine."
~ Wes Fessler
Affection
"Affection is the glue that bonds families together."
~ Wes Fessler
Attention
"Show as much interest in what your children tell you as they have in telling you."
~ Wes Fessler

Caring
"Caring opens up the heart to offer from the soul, a greater love and joy that bonds two hearts into a whole."
~ Wes Fessler

Change
"When you're finished changing, you're finished."
~ Benjamin Franklin

Charity
"The true glory of standing on top is the ability to lift others higher."
~ Wes Fesler

Commitment
"There is no better asset, nor worse liability than one's personal level of commitment."
~ Wes Fesler
Compassion
"Compassion conquers without casualties."
~ Wes Fesler
Compromise
"When all roads lead to the same destination, never assume that yours is the only way."
~ Wes Fesler
Conscience
"There are no easy answers, but there are simple answers. We must have the courage to do what we know is right."
~ Ronald Reagan

Courage
"Courage is turning who you wish you could be into who you are."
~ Wes Fesler

Discipline
"There can be no true discipline without love...only compliance."
~ Wes Fesler

Dreams
"A dream may be achieved by one weary of hope, but never by one who quits."
~ Wes Fesler

Example
"You must never forget in good or bad, that you are always an example."
~ Wes Fesler

Fairness
"Fairness is man's ability to rise above his prejudices."
~ Wes Fesler

Forgiveness
"Grudges are dark dungeons of your mind for which forgiveness is your only escape."
~ Wes Fesler
Fun
"Sometimes fun is just being together."
~ Wes Fesler
Gratitude
"He is a wise man who does not grieve for the things which he has not, but rejoices for those which he has."
~ Epictetus

Honesty
"Lies are like garbage that you can't throw away. They clutter your life, foul your air, and make living unbearable."
~ Wes Fessler

Jealousy
"Jealousy is the fire of envy that seeks to destroy another's beauty, rather than to create its own."
~ Wes Fessler
Kindness
"The simplest kindness is the difference between a day fulfilled and a day wasted."
~ Wes Fessler
Love
"Love will only exist when you value another's happiness as much as your own."
~ Wes Fessler
Mercy
"In every advantage over another, consider the possibility that mercy may be the most powerful course of action."
~ Wes Fessler
Mistakes
"The only failure in a mistake is the failure to learn a lesson."
~ Wes Fessler
Optimism
"Pessimists beat their heads against walls, while optimists open doors."
~ Wes Fessler
Passion
"Passion is the ability to soar with nothing but heart."
~ Wes Fessler
Patience
"Patience without purpose is procrastination. Be sure you know what you are waiting for."
~ Wes Fessler
Perseverance
"Difficult challenges are consistently overcome by willingness to adapt and refusal to quit."
~ Wes Fessler
Potential
"The only limitation of your potential is the number of your breaths."
~ Wes Fessler
Respect
"Everyone deserves respect until proven otherwise."
~ Wes Fessler
Responsibility
"If no one among us is capable of governing himself, then who among us has the capacity to govern someone else."
~ Ronald Reagan

Talents
"Whatever you are by nature, keep to it; never desert your line of talent. Be what nature intended you for and you will succeed."
~ Sydney Smith

Trust
"The most important consideration in finding someone to trust is being someone to trust."
~ Wes Fessler
